Key Points
Athyrium filix-femina ‘Frizelliae’ is a captivating and compact cultivar of the lady fern, commonly known as the tatting fern due to its intricately beaded pinnae that resemble delicate lacework. Each narrow, arching frond features tiny rounded lobes that march along the central midrib, creating a texture that is both intricate and enchanting. Deciduous by nature, ‘Frizelliae’ forms tidy, clump-forming tufts of foliage, perfect for adding refined structure and a hint of whimsy to shaded corners of the garden.
This fern thrives in moist, humus-rich, neutral to acid soils and flourishes in full to partial shade. It is hardy and forgiving, tolerant of slightly drier conditions once established, and generally pest- and disease-free. Awarded the Royal Horticultural Society’s Award of Garden Merit, ‘Frizelliae’ is a reliable and striking choice—equally at home in woodland borders, containers, rock garden edges, or along shaded water features.
